Transaction f2bd909aee4f3402c6d86fc9a73441a053a36cd463e245fd5bddfa311942f55d
1 Input
1 Output
-
f2bd909aee4f3402c6d86fc9a73441a053a36cd463e245fd5bddfa311942f55d:0
- value
- 391582639
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c27a98bc3e0ca8028baa9ad934058d70b4febfb OP_EQUAL
- address
- 3EU63Bdkwy5DccaWADSLhwweoLy4jkLT5A